It has been a great ride so far with new features added to the Miniplayer on mobile like resizing it and even moving it anywhere the viewer wants. This enhancement helps the users perform other tasks simultaneously with watching videos and therefore enhances flexibility. Now, people who like to look for more clues to watch can easily switch from watching to browsing.
Specifically, YouTube has also overhauled its playlist function, adding a collective element to share a QR code or the link with friends and family. This semi-automated innovation makes it easier for many users to add their preferred videos to the same playlist, making the process more social. That makes friends let’s compile a perfect playlist of videos which would captivate the attention of the audience in accordance with the specific interests.
New soon to arrive will be a voting feature to improve how playlists are sorted. Based on the idea selection, users will be able to vote for those they want to be included in the collaborative playlist helping decide which videos are best selected. Not only does this feature get you more involved but it also makes sure that everyone’s numerous choices and options are noted.
In this update, YouTube has decided to incorporate custom thumbnails for playlists as the other collaborative tools. It will help update playlist visuals to enable users to style their playlists and make them more appealing and easily identifiable. Different playlists can have different thumbnails according to the theme or mood that each playlist can represent and improve the experience of general browsing.

YouTube latest Features Sleep Timer
Additionally for you everyday YouTubers the long awaited Sleep Timer option is now here after theacea with Premium subscribers in the first half of the year. This feature is particularly great for listening to music or watching some relaxing videos because what YouTube does, it pauses the playtime after the selected duration. This addition improves the view, for those who like to relax before bed without the sound of the video playing all night.
On YouTube TV, there is a neat change of user interface for short videos that makes it easy to view them on the television. This improvement is especially relevant now that the length of Shorts has now been increased to a maximum of three minutes, and hence the name, is a little misleading. The redesigned UI is tailored to improve the ways of watching content in an effortless manner in big screens, says the company.
